What is Window Condensation?

Condensation takes place when warm, wet air enters contact with a cooler surface, such as a windowpane. The water vapor in the air cools and changes back into liquid, forming beads on the window. This procedure is influenced by temperature level, humidity levels, and the insulation properties of the window.

Causes of Window Condensation

Comprehending the causes of window condensation can assist in resolving the issue efficiently. Here are some common contributors:

  1. High Interior Humidity: Activities like cooking, bathing, and drying clothes inside your home can considerably increase humidity levels in a home.
  2. Poor Insulation: Windows that are not properly insulated will be cooler, triggering moist air to condense more readily on their surface areas.
  3. Temperature level Differences: A stark contrast in between indoor and outdoor temperature levels can cause increased condensation, especially in winter season.
  4. Absence of Ventilation: Inadequate air flow can result in stagnant, damp air building up inside your home.

Effects of Window Condensation

While condensation itself might seem harmless, it can lead to a number of problems that can impact the integrity of a home:

  1. Mold Growth: Persistent moisture can create a perfect environment for mold and mildew, which can adversely impact indoor air quality.
  2. Wood Rot: Excess moisture can trigger wood frames and sills to rot, leading to costly repairs.
  3. Damage to Window Seals: Continuous condensation can deteriorate window seals, causing air leaks and decreased energy performance.
  4. Lessened Aesthetic Appeal: Water beads on windows block exposure and can develop a negative impression of tidiness and maintenance.

Solutions and Prevention

Managing condensation involves managing humidity levels and improving ventilation. Here are some practical solutions:

  1. Use Dehumidifiers: Reduce humidity levels by utilizing portable dehumidifiers, particularly in rooms prone to excess moisture.
  2. Improve Insulation: Invest in energy-efficient windows with much better insulating homes to minimize temperature level differences.
  3. Boost Ventilation: Ensure correct air flow by installing exhaust fans in kitchens and bathrooms, and consider cross-ventilation methods in living locations.
  4. Change Indoor Activities: Limit activities that generate moisture, such as drying clothing inside your home or taking long, hot showers without ventilation.
  5. Make Use Of Window Treatments: Consider using insulated drapes or tones to keep the glass warmer and lower condensation.
